Bordas redondas com CSS

Postado por: Pedro Rogério em

Segue abaixo um simples código para se produzir bordas redondas com CSS:

border-radius: 9px; /* CSS 3 */
-o-border-radius: 9px; /* Opera */
-icab-border-radius: 9px; /* iCab */
-khtml-border-radius: 9px; /* Konqueror */
-moz-border-radius: 9px; /* Firefox */
-webkit-border-radius: 9px; /* Safari */

Internet Explorer? Como ele não possui suporte a CSS 3, a solução seria ignorá-lo, ou então utilizar JavaScript ou imagens. Exemplo.

Posts Relacionados

Confira também outros artigos interessantes postados aqui no blog.

Sobre Pedro Rogério

Pedro Rogério é desenvolvedor web por paixão, não saberia fazer melhor outra coisa. Além de escrever para o CSS no Lanche também escreve para o Pinceladas da Web, blog com assuntos gerais sobre desenvolvimento web.

Central Server

12 Responses to “Bordas redondas com CSS”

  1. Neto disse:

    Muito fera, infelizmente para o nosso querido IE (brincadeira né) hahaha só Javascript para salvar :(

  2. Leandro disse:

    IE um navegador “quadrado”…

  3. Diego disse:

    Ninguém usa o IE mesmo né… pra que pensar nele.

  4. A propriedade do Opera não funciona mais… :-(

  5. Dina disse:

    É, no Opera não rolou… =/
    Mas valeu a info!

  6. Maldito trident (engine do IE) do capeta.
    Existe só para complicar nossa vida, forçando fazer gambiarras contorcionistas ao invés de uma definição CSS simples desse jeito.

    Po, Ballmer, muda logo essa joça pra Webkit!!!!

  7. Abimael disse:

    vi por aí, que no ópera usa-se -opera- e não -o-, não tenho o mesmo aqui, testem…

    o Chrome funciona normalmente. (:

Leave a Reply